Presidents of Turkmenistan and South Korea Hold First Telephone Conversation

On Friday, 29 August 2025, the first telephone conversation took place between President of Turkmenistan Serdar Berdimuhamedov and President of the Republic of Korea Lee Jae Myung, marking their first direct contact since President Lee assumed office. The news was confirmed by the press service of the South Korean President.

During the exchange, President Lee Jae Myung expressed his sincere appreciation to his Turkmen counterpart. He thanked President Berdimuhamedov for the congratulatory letter sent on the occasion of his inauguration, as well as for Turkmenistan’s invaluable assistance in June, when 59 South Korean citizens located in Iran were able to safely evacuate via Turkmen territory amid shifting dynamics in the Middle East.

President Lee commended the deepening and expansion of bilateral cooperation since the elevation of diplomatic relations to a mutually beneficial partnership in 2008. Over the years, both nations have achieved notable progress across various sectors. Recognizing these accomplishments, the two Presidents agreed to further strengthen and broaden their ties.

Particular emphasis was placed on collaboration in key areas such as energy and the implementation of industrial infrastructure projects.

Concluding the conversation, the presidents agreed to maintain close contact in preparation for the upcoming “Republic of Korea – Central Asia” Summit, scheduled to be held in South Korea next year.
